The combination of speed and context often distinguishes successful traders from the rest. Trading in DMAC shares today saw a decline of approximately 2.76%, bringing the price to $5.99. This move occurred amid a broader rotation out of speculative small-cap biotech names, with many early-stage drug developers experiencing similar pullbacks. The volume during the session was moderately elevated compared to the stock’s recent average, indicating increased participation—likely driven by profit-taking after a period of relative stability. Sector positioning remains mixed; while the broader biotech index has shown signs of resilience, individual stories like DiaMedica’s depend heavily on pipeline catalysts. The company’s lead program, DM199 for acute ischemic stroke, continues to be the primary focus for investors, and any clinical updates—or lack thereof—directly influence short-term price action. Today’s decline may also reflect a lack of fresh news, as traders adjust positions in a low-catalyst environment. The $5.99 close places DMAC closer to its established support zone, suggesting that near-term directional bias could hinge on broader market risk appetite and any updates from the company regarding its ongoing Phase 2/3 studies.

Continuous learning is part of the process. From a technical perspective, DMAC’s current price of $5.99 sits just above the identified support level at $5.69. This support level has historically acted as a floor during pullbacks, with buyers stepping in near that price point. On the upside, resistance stands at $6.29, a level that has capped advances in recent weeks. The relative strength index (RSI) is likely in the mid-30s to low-40s range, suggesting that the stock may be approaching oversold territory but has not yet triggered a definitive reversal signal. Price action patterns show a series of lower highs over the past several sessions, indicating a short-term downtrend. However, the declining momentum appears to be decelerating—a potential precursor to a consolidation phase. The moving averages—specifically the 50-day and 200-day—are likely converging or showing a flattening trajectory, which could offer a clearer setup once the stock decisively breaks either support or resistance. Volume trends during the decline have been consistent, without a panic sell-off, suggesting that the move is orderly rather than driven by a specific negative catalyst. For trend followers, a break below $5.69 could open the door to further downside, while a reclaim of $6.29 would shift the bias bullish.

Continuous learning is part of the process. Looking ahead, DiaMedica’s stock could find direction based on several factors. A successful test of the $5.69 support level may attract buyers who view the valuation as attractive, potentially leading to a bounce toward the $6.29 resistance. Conversely, if selling pressure intensifies, a break below $5.69 could expose the stock to the next support zone in the $5.30–$5.40 range. Key catalysts that could influence future performance include updates on the ongoing REGAIN-1 trial for DM199 in acute ischemic stroke, particularly any interim data or regulatory communications. Positive efficacy signals could drive a sharp rally, while delays or negative results might weigh on sentiment. Additionally, broader market conditions—such as interest rate expectations and risk appetite for small-cap biotech—may play a role in DMAC’s near-term trajectory. The stock’s relatively low market capitalization means that significant moves can occur on modest volumes, so investors should remain aware of volatility. While the current price action suggests caution, the potential for clinical breakthroughs remains the primary long-term driver. Watching volume patterns around key price levels could provide early clues about the next directional move.
